Underground water tanks are favored by users due to their small surface area, corrosion resistance, and low cost. In fact, when buried water tanks are deep underground, it is easy to encounter situations such as groundwater leakage or self leakage due to tank damage. As the entire water tank is buried underground, when leakage occurs, the leaked water will generate buoyancy, lift the water tank, and cause damage to the water tank. Therefore, the design of anti floating buried water tanks is very necessary for buried water tanks.

The three common overall anti floating methods for buried water tanks are: increasing the pressure weight, using anti floating anchor rods, and using anti displacement piles. Underground water tanks often use anti floating piles to resist floating. Anti pull pile, also known as anti floating pile, is a type of pile that can withstand tension. Ordinary anti floating piles also transmit force from the top to the bottom of the pile, and the magnitude of the force on the pile changes with the groundwater level. Anti pull pile refers to various types of piles that resist upward displacement of buildings. Unlike general foundation piles, anti pull piles have their own performance.


Newly designed prefabricated BDF box pump integrated fire pump stationCorrect order:

1. Earthwork excavation: Confirm the order and slope of excavation - excavate in sections and layers evenly - trim and clear the edges and bottom.

2. The outer side of the box is coated with epoxy coal tar roller coating, with a thickness of 2-3mm.

3. The fastener adopts two layers of epoxy zinc rich primer and two layers of epoxy glass flake surface coating.

4. Pressure test: Manually start each water pump separately, test the pressure at 1.2 times the set pressure for 15 minutes, and set the pressure relief value of the safety relief valve at 1.1 times the design pressure.

5. Grounding: All equipment must be grounded.

6. The soil covering around the pump station shall be uniformly compacted layer by layer every 500mm, and the top plate shall be compacted using a frog or plate vibration compactor. The soil covering shall be 1.0m deep

7. Determination of slope: The excavation slope of this project is determined according to the local soil conditions.

8. The outlet pipe, sewage pipe, inlet pipe and external pipeline of the pump station are connected by flanges.

9. Water testing: After the installation of the pump station is completed, inject water for 24 hours.

10. Connect the dual power supply to the PAE dual power control cabinet.


When designing an underground water tank, it is necessary to clearly analyze the anti buoyancy and buoyancy. The anti buoyancy design should be calculated based on the anti buoyancy design water level issued by the geological report. The advantage of the anti buoyancy water level will affect the selection of the foundation form. The buried box pump integrated fire constant pressure water supply pump station is composed of pipeline system, water tank system, water pump system, control system, etc. The water tank system primarily consists of a water tank and a manhole; The pipeline system mainly consists of inlet pipes, fire water pipes, electrical contact pressure gauges, and various valves; The water pump system mainly consists of submersible multi-stage fire pumps and pump rooms; The control system primarily consists of a fire intelligent control cabinet, an air pressure tank, and a control room. The silent check valve is connected to the pump chamber with bolts for sealing, and the pump chamber is also connected to the control room with bolts for sealing. The water pump system is placed in the water tank, and the control room and water tank are planned as a whole. Its characteristic is that there is an electric contact pressure gauge on the fire pipeline; The intelligent boosting and stabilizing control cabinet for fire protection is equipped with a processing controller. After adopting the above plan, the water pressure in the fire pipeline was stabilized, the integration of the box pump was processed, space was saved, the service life of the water pump and motor was extended, and the fire protection effect was ensured.
